Role description

Selection Criteria

Your application for this position should specifically address each of the selection criteria below.  Short listing and selection will be based upon responses to these selection criteria and key responsibility areas.

 

SC1. Proven ability to work as part of a team, be adaptable and flexible and be able to take direction as required.

SC2. Demonstrated understanding of client services, and experience in providing a friendly and efficient service within the College Library

SC3. Ability to manage time, work independently and determine priorities of work with some supervision

SC4. Sound knowledge in the use of Microsoft Office Suite, software and technical equipment as relevant to this position

SC5. Good oral, written and interpersonal communication skills
SC6. A good standard of numeracy and literacy with personal skills of accuracy, precision and personal organization and planning

SC7. Demonstrated commitment to OH&S

 

Role

People employed at this level work under routine direction and undertake a variety of duties as directed within the College Library.

This position may involve giving basic technical and procedural advice to other staff, teachers, students or parents. It may require some knowledge and application of specific procedures, instructions or other requirements relating to general administration and/or specific College programs or activities.
